Waghlud Population - Jalgaon, Maharashtra

Waghlud is a medium size village located in Yawal Taluka of Jalgaon district, Maharashtra with total 61 families residing. The Waghlud village has population of 268 of which 140 are males while 128 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Waghlud village population of children with age 0-6 is 43 which makes up 16.04 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Waghlud village is 914 which is lower than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Waghlud as per census is 593, lower than Maharashtra average of 894.

Waghlud village has higher liter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Waghlud village was 89.78 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Waghlud Male literacy stands at 95.58 % while female literacy rate was 83.93 %.

Caste Factor

Waghlud village of Jalgaon has substantial population of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 32.84 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 5.60 % of total population in Waghlud village.

Work Profile

In Waghlud village out of total population, 152 were engaged in work activities. 98.03 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 1.97 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 152 workers engaged in Main Work, 41 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 94 were Agricultural labourer.
